Emergency Services nearby 16 Kenmore Avenue, London, Harrow HA3 8PQ, United Kingdom

Abhicom Electronics Ltd

Approximately 0.49 km away
Address: Phoenix Industrial Estate, Unit A3 Rosslyn Crescent, Harrow, Middlesx HA1 2SP, United Kingdom

Wealdstone Police Station

Approximately 1.04 km away
Address: Station road, Harrow HA1 2UU, United Kingdom

Harrow Central Police Station

Approximately 1.63 km away
Address: Kirkland House, 11-15 Peterborough Rd, Harrow, Middlesex HA1 2AX, United Kingdom